assessment of the impact of kaolin mining
The extraction of kaolin, a clay mineral widely used in industries such as ceramics, paper, and cosmetics, has significant environmental and socio-economic implications. While kaolin mining contributes to local economies by creating jobs and generating revenue, its environmental footprint cannot be overlooked. The process often involves large-scale land clearing, which disrupts ecosystems and reduces biodiversity. Additionally, the removal of topsoil and vegetation can lead to soil erosion, altering the landscape and affecting agricultural productivity in surrounding areas.
Water pollution is another critical concern associated with kaolin mining. The washing and processing of kaolin require substantial amounts of water, often leading to the contamination of nearby water bodies with sediment and chemicals. This can harm aquatic life and compromise the quality of drinking water for local communities. In regions where water scarcity is already a challenge, the excessive use of water for mining operations exacerbates the problem, straining resources needed for agriculture and domestic use.

On the socio-economic front, kaolin mining can bring both benefits and challenges. While it provides employment opportunities and stimulates local economies, the long-term sustainability of these benefits is questionable. Many mining operations are temporary, leaving communities with depleted resources and limited alternatives once the mines are exhausted. Furthermore, the influx of workers can strain local infrastructure and social services, leading to conflicts between residents and mining companies.

Efforts to mitigate the negative impacts of kaolin mining include stricter environmental regulations, improved waste management practices, and community engagement initiatives. Rehabilitation of mined land through reforestation and soil restoration can help restore ecosystems and reduce long-term damage. However, these measures require consistent enforcement and collaboration between governments, companies, and local communities to be effective.
In conclusion, while kaolin mining plays a vital role in various industries, its environmental and socio-economic consequences demand careful consideration. Balancing economic growth with sustainable practices is essential to ensure that the benefits of kaolin extraction do not come at the expense of ecosystems and communities. Addressing these challenges requires a holistic approach that prioritizes environmental protection, resource efficiency, and equitable development.
